The utility model discloses an air chamber cleaning device for a lost foam sand box, wherein the air chamber is provided with a hollow tube flush with a side wall of the sand box, a plurality of air holes arranged in an orderly manner along the axial direction of the hollow tube are arranged on the wall of the hollow tube, an opening is arranged at the top corner of the air chamber arranged around the sand box, and a sealing member is detachably installed in the opening, the sealing member comprises a sealing plate, a top plate, a bottom plate and a sealing rubber block, the upper and lower ends of the plate surface of the sealing plate facing the sand box are respectively provided with a top plate and a bottom plate which are in contact with the upper and lower surfaces of the air chamber, and a sealing rubber block which is located between the top plate and the bottom plate and is interference-fitted with the opening is also provided on the side of the sealing plate facing the sand box; the utility model not only avoids the situation that the air chamber needs to be cut in the traditional method to clean up debris, greatly improves the cleaning and care efficiency of the air chamber, reduces the working difficulty and workload of the staff, but also can effectively improve the flow speed of the air in the air chamber, thereby effectively reducing the situation that dust adheres to the inner wall of the air chamber.

Description

Cleaning device for air chamber of lost foam sand box
Technical Field
The utility model relates to the technical field of lost foam vacuum systems, in particular to a lost foam sand box air chamber cleaning device.
Background
The lost foam negative pressure system comprises a vacuum pump, a gas storage tank, a main pipeline, a negative pressure distributor and a sand box, wherein a lost foam pattern cluster is placed in the sand box, sand grains are filled around the lost foam pattern cluster, a layer of stainless steel screen is arranged between a gas chamber of the sand box and the sand, dust of the sand box and tar-like residues generated by burning the white mould can be adhered to the inner surface of the gas chamber of the sand box through the stainless steel screen when negative pressure is pumped, the gas chamber of the sand box can be gradually blocked by accumulated residues, so that pumping negative pressure energy consumption is increased, negative pressure in the sand box is reduced, the white mould cannot be fully combusted, molten steel is reversely sprayed when casting is performed, and casting is insufficient.
However, the existing air chambers are mostly welded and fixed on the side wall of the sand box, when the air chamber of the sand box is cleaned, the air chamber is required to be completely cut off from the sand box by using a gas cutting gun, the air chamber is required to be cleaned after being separated from the right-angle joint of the air chamber, the air chamber is required to be welded on the sand box again after being cleaned, the air chamber is polished and leveled, the cleaning mode is troublesome to operate and long in use, sand grains splash in the gas cutting process, and certain damage is caused to operators, so that the cleaning device for the air chamber of the lost foam sand box is required.

Detailed Description
In the description, it should be understood that, if there is an azimuth or positional relationship indicated by terms such as "upper", "lower", "front", "rear", "left", "right", etc., the drawings merely correspond to the drawings of the present utility model, and in order to facilitate description of the present utility model, it is not necessary to indicate or imply that the apparatus or element to be referred to has a specific azimuth.
Referring to fig. 1-6 of the specification, the present utility model provides a technical scheme:
The first embodiment is that the cleaning device for the air chamber of the lost foam sand box comprises a sand box 1 and an air chamber 2 arranged around the sand box 1, wherein a hollow pipe 6 which is flat with the side wall of the sand box 1 is arranged in the air chamber 2, the hollow pipe 6 is fixedly connected with the sand box 1 through a plurality of connecting rods 17, a plurality of air holes 16 which are orderly arranged along the axial direction of the hollow pipe 6 are arranged on the pipe wall of the hollow pipe 6, and in order to ensure that the flow direction of air flow in the air chamber is always kept, the plurality of air holes 16 on the hollow pipe 6 are all in the shape of the same direction inclination;
The top corner of the air chamber 2 arranged around the sand box 1 is provided with an opening 5, a plugging piece 3 is detachably arranged in the opening 5, the plugging piece 3 comprises a plugging plate 11, a top plate 9, a bottom plate 14 and a sealing rubber block 13, the size of the plugging plate 11 is larger than that of the opening 5, the upper end and the lower end of the surface of the plugging plate 11 facing the sand box 1 are respectively provided with a top plate 9 and a bottom plate 14, which are in contact with the upper surface and the lower surface of the air chamber 2, the end surfaces of the upper end and the lower end of the opening 5 are respectively provided with a mounting screw hole 4, the top plate 9 and the bottom plate 14 are respectively provided with a limiting screw hole 8 corresponding to the mounting screw hole 4, the corresponding mounting screw holes 4 are internally screwed with the limiting screw holes 8, in order to ensure that the ends of the top plate 9 and the bottom plate 14 are tightly contacted with the side wall of the sand box 1, the ends of the top plate 9 and the bottom plate 14 are provided with openings 10 which are matched with the surface of the sand box 1, the surface of the plugging plate 11 is provided with a handle 12 on the surface of the plugging plate 11 facing the back of the sand box 1, one side of the plugging plate 11 is also provided with a sealing block 13 which is positioned between the top plate 9 and the bottom plate 14 and is in contact with the sealing rubber block 5 in interference fit with the opening 5, the end surfaces of the sealing rubber block 6 is further opposite to improve the sealing effect of the sealing rubber block 9 and the upper end surfaces of the opening 9 and the opening 9;
When the air chamber 2 is cleaned, a worker only needs to take down the blocking piece 3, high-pressure air is injected into the air chamber 2 through the opening 5, sundries in the air chamber 2 can be flushed out by utilizing the high-pressure air, and in order to realize efficient cleaning of dust adhered to the inner wall of the air chamber 2, the outside of the air chamber 2 can be heated and beaten, and the dust adhered to the inner wall of the air chamber 2 can be effectively dropped and flushed out along with the high-pressure air.
In the second embodiment, in order to ensure the sealing performance of the air chamber 2, the number of the openings 5 on the air chamber 2 is one, and correspondingly, the hollow tube 6 is arranged around the sand box 1 along the air chamber 2, and both ends of the hollow tube 6 are located in the openings 5. During cleaning, high-pressure gas is injected into the gas chamber 2 through the same opening 5, flows along the gas chamber 2, and is discharged through the opening 5.
In order to improve the cleaning and nursing efficiency of the air chamber 2, the air chamber 2 is provided with openings 5 at each vertex angle, the number of hollow tubes 6 is matched with the number of the side walls of the sand box 1, each hollow tube 6 is parallel to the side walls of the adjacent sand box 1, two ends of each hollow tube 6 are respectively located in the similar openings 5, and the flowing distance of high-pressure air can be effectively shortened through the arrangement of the openings 5 and the hollow tubes 6, so that the impact force of the high-pressure air is increased, and the cleaning efficiency of sundries is improved.
